                                                                 In this workshop, Asdis will take you through the basics of using watercolor pencils on fabric.  She will show you techniques and effects you can achieve in this very simple process. Hand embroidery will be stitched after the block is coloured.

Asdis will bring designs for you to select from, or you may bring your own image or design to work from.

Materials to Bring

-       Cotton fabric (offwhite ) 8“x 12“  (Scraps for applequie Fliso fix) Free choice

-       Fusible web (light-weight for applique scraps)

-     Cotton iron-on stabilizer

-     DMC Embroidery thread
-     Basic sewing kit: Scissors, Needles, etc

-     Embroidery ring  (optional)

     watercolour pencils (Derwent preferred)
